301538, ATHENIAN, Copenhagen, National Museum, 3672

  • Vase Number: 301538
  • Fabric: ATHENIAN
  • Technique: BLACK-FIGURE
  • Shape Name: PSEUDO-PANATHENAIC AMPHORA
  • Provenance: ITALY, ORVIETO
  • Date: -550 TO -500
  • Attributed To: SWING P by BEAZLEY
  • Decoration: A: ATHENA WITH OWL BETWEEN COLUMNS SURMOUNTED BY PANTHERS, DEVICE, DISCS
    B: GIGANTOMACHY, POSEIDON WITH ROCK (NISYROS), GIANT FALLING WITH STONE, BETWEEN WOMEN WITH SPEARS
  • Last Recorded Collection: Copenhagen, National Museum: 3672
  • Publication Record: Beazley, J.D., Attic Black-Figure Vase-Painters (Oxford, 1956): 307.58
    Carpenter, T.H., with Mannack, T. and Mendonca, M., Beazley Addenda, 2nd edition (Oxford, 1989): 82
    Corpus Vasorum Antiquorum: COPENHAGEN, NATIONAL MUSEUM 3, 84, PL.(107) 105.1A, 105.1B View Whole CVA Plates
    Dietrich, N., Figur ohne Raum? Bäume und Felsen in der attischen Vasenmalerei des 6. und 5. Jahrhunderts v. Chr., Image & Context 7 (Berlin, 2010): 326, FIG.262 (B)
    Lexicon Iconographicum Mythologiae Classicae: VII, PL.368, POSEIDON 174 (B)
    Stansbury-O'Donnell, M.D., Vase Painting, Gender, and Social Identity in Archaic Athens (Cambridge, 2006): 194, FIG.63 (B)
